GatheringSense: AI-Generated Imagery and Embodied Experiences for Understanding Literati Gatherings

Published 13 Feb 2026 in cs.HC | (2602.12565v1)

Abstract: Chinese literati gatherings (Wenren Yaji), as a situated form of Chinese traditional culture, remain underexplored in depth. Although generative AI supports powerful multimodal generation, current cultural applications largely emphasize aesthetic reproduction and struggle to convey the deeper meanings of cultural rituals and social frameworks. Based on embodied cognition, we propose an AI-driven dual-path framework for cultural understanding, which we instantiate through GatheringSense, a literati-gathering experience. We conduct a mixed-methods study (N=48) to compare how AI-generated multimodal content and embodied participation complement each other in supporting the understanding of literati gatherings and fostering cultural resonance. Our results show that AI-generated content effectively improves the readability of cultural symbols and initial emotional attraction, yet limitations in physical coherence and micro-level credibility may affect users' satisfaction. In contrast, embodied experience significantly deepens participants' understanding of ritual rules and social roles, and increases their psychological closeness and presence. Based on these findings, we offer empirical evidence and five transferable design implications for generative experience in cultural heritage.

Summary

  • The paper introduces GatheringSense, a dual-path framework that combines AI-generated multimodal scenes with physically enacted rituals to support cultural understanding through seeing, perceiving, and resonating.
  • In a mixed-methods study of 48 participants, embodied experience significantly increased cultural resonance from 4.73 to 5.54 and psychological closeness from 3.00 to 4.66, while presence strongly correlated with resonance (ρ=.66, p<.001).
  • The findings show that ink-wash and fine-brush styles improve semantic clarity, while personalization, ritual participation, social interaction, and exploration matter more to user satisfaction than extensive knowledge guidance or real-time AI feedback.

Overview and motivation

This paper addresses a persistent gap in digital cultural heritage: systems can render cultural symbols visible, but rarely convey the procedural rules, role structures, and social atmospheres that constitute complex cultural practices. The authors ground their argument in Geertz's notion of "thick description" and in embodied cognition theory, arguing that practices such as Chinese literati gatherings (Wenren Yaji)—which interweave poetry, calligraphy, painting, music, and tea ceremony within ritualized turn-taking and spatial choreography—cannot be understood through observation alone. Their response is an AI-driven dual-path framework combining (1) an AI symbolic path, in which AI-generated multimodal content makes scenes, activities, and roles recognizable, and (2) an embodied experience path, in which participants physically enact the gathering's behavioral logic. The two paths are linked by a three-stage cognitive relay: "Seeing – Perceiving – Resonating." The framework is instantiated as GatheringSense and evaluated in a mixed-methods study (N=48N=48) with three research questions covering initial understanding from AI content (RQ1), embodied contributions to immersion and social presence (RQ2), and how the paths jointly foster cultural resonance (RQ3).

The paper's positioning against prior work is well supported. Existing generative-AI cultural applications emphasize aesthetic reproduction and lack cultural semantic alignment (2602.12565), while immersive heritage systems focus on artifact reconstruction rather than structured social activity patterns. GatheringSense is distinctive in explicitly designing for social presence, ritual participation, and role transitions, and in quantifying these with validated instruments.

Experience design

The study corpus draws on five canonical texts spanning the Wei–Jin through Yuan periods, including the Preface to the Orchid Pavilion Gathering and the Record of the Elegant Gathering in the Western Garden. Four core activities—pitch-pot (touhu), Go, calligraphy, and poetry singing—were selected for historical frequency, symbolic value, and feasibility of physical enactment.

The AI visualization pipeline used GPT-5 for semantic extraction, then compared four text-to-image models (gpt-image-1, Dou Bao AI, Stable Diffusion 3.5, Flux Pro 1.1 Ultra), finding Dou Bao AI strongest for ink-wash and fine-brush styles and gpt-image-1 for oil and cartoon styles. Sixteen key frames (four activities × four styles) were interpolated into 30–40 s videos via Jimeng 2.0, with AI-generated guqin/xiao soundscapes from Suno. Notably, the authors report that generation models struggled with pitch-pot—a culturally unfamiliar, physically dynamic activity—and its video was subsequently poorly received, an honest early signal of AIGC limits on procedural content.

The embodied path was staged in a laboratory configured as a gathering space with a curved screen, circular seating, structured prop-passing paths, ambient music, and role rotation between performer and observer. Substitutes preserved symbolic fidelity while ensuring safety (e.g., Gomoku replaced Go for session-duration reasons).

Method

Participants were 48 people divided into four groups: Chinese adults in forward order (G1, N=23N=23; AI then embodied), Chinese adults in reverse order (G2, N=15N=15; embodied then AI), cross-cultural adults (G3, N=4N=4), and children aged 7–10 (G4, N=6N=6). Only G1+G2 entered inferential analyses; G3/G4 were exploratory. The sample was deliberately "technologically familiar but culturally unfamiliar" (AIGC experience M=4.57M=4.57, literati familiarity M=3.24M=3.24 on 7-point scales), which suits testing the framework under low prior knowledge.

Measures included a Film-IEQ proxy for interpretability of images vs. videos, a custom Cultural Resonance (CR) scale administered at three stages, selected ITC-SOPI items for embodied presence, IOS for psychological closeness to the cultural concept, SAM at four time points, KANO questionnaires over ten candidate features, association-keyword elicitation, and semi-structured interviews analyzed via reflexive thematic analysis. Quantitative analysis used linear mixed models with planned contrasts and Tukey corrections.

Quantitative results

Media format and style. Static images outperformed videos on the Film-IEQ proxy (M=5.28M=5.28, SD=1.01SD=1.01 vs. M=5.04M=5.04, N=23N=230; N=23N=231, N=23N=232), indicating that key frames clarify "who is doing what" better than short clips, while video contributes mainly dynamic and affective information. Style rankings strongly favored ink-wash (N=23N=233) and fine-brush (N=23N=234) over oil (N=23N=235) and cartoon (N=23N=236). The authors attribute this to style–semantic alignment: culturally congruent brushwork lexicons reduce cognitive load, whereas cross-cultural or modern abstractions weaken semantic fit. This yields a concrete design rule—use ink-wash/fine-brush as primary narrative carriers and reserve oil/cartoon for contrast.

Resonance trajectory. CR was already mid-high after AI media (CR_img N=23N=237; CR_vid N=23N=238; difference n.s.), but rose significantly to N=23N=239 post-experience (N=15N=150, N=15N=151). Embodied presence correlated strongly with post-study resonance (N=15N=152, N=15N=153), while prior familiarity with literati gatherings did not (N=15N=154, N=15N=155). The implication is notable: participants initially unfamiliar with the practice could reach high cultural resonance given sufficient embodied presence, supporting the claim that embodiment—not prior knowledge—is the operative lever.

Psychological closeness and order effects. IOS increased from N=15N=156 to N=15N=157 overall (N=15N=158, N=15N=159). Critically, the gain was larger when embodiment preceded AI media (G2: N=4N=40) than the reverse (G1: N=4N=41; N=4N=42, N=4N=43), suggesting embodied experience has a stronger initiating effect on reducing psychological distance, with subsequent AI content consolidating structure. However, the authors caution that per-group sample sizes were modest, so order-effect conclusions should be interpreted cautiously—an appropriate concession given the small G2.

Affect. SAM remained stable across phases (valence 4.16–4.68, arousal 4.89–5.24), which the authors frame as intentional: the system targets a stable emotional background rather than arousal peaks, with change occurring in structural understanding and identification instead.

KANO analysis. Seven of ten features (F2–F8) were classified Attractive; none were Must-be or One-dimensional. Personalization had the highest N=4N=44 (78.57%), followed by ritual participation (78.05%) and environmental immersion/exploration freedom (both 76.19%). Social interaction and exploration freedom carried the largest dissatisfaction coefficients (N=4N=45). Content breadth, knowledge guidance, and AI real-time feedback were Indifferent (e.g., F9 N=4N=46). The strong implication is that users do not want didactic knowledge delivery; satisfaction hinges on agency, ritual, and social structure—"being one of the gathering"—rather than on visible AI capability or explanatory completeness.

Qualitative results

Association data (3,214 word occurrences across G1+G2) showed that both groups first constructed static scenes around environment (~30% of core words) and material media (~27%), but shifted toward specific cultural identities ("literati," "scholars"), nuanced affective vocabulary ("refined," "secluded"), and activity-specific action verbs ("composing," "chanting," "wielding")—independent linguistic evidence for the seeing-to-resonating relay.

Interviews reinforced a clear division of labor. AI content served as an entry point and "problem space": participants valued ink-wash/fine-brush for elegance and contextual fit but were highly sensitive to physical incoherence—clipping, distorted hand positions, motions violating real-world logic—with one participant summarizing, "It gives me a rough feeling; I treat the details as AI bugs." After embodied experience, tolerance improved: one participant reported that having performed pitch-pot, they could "guess what it wants to express" even when the video was inaccurate. The embodied path built presence through ritual and social interaction—Go etiquette read as "a kind of Li," pitch-pot as a "social catalyst"—amplified by setting and music. Participants also acknowledged limits: some stayed in a "playful, appreciative attitude" without fully entering the historical context, indicating that fun alone does not produce deep understanding without scripting and guidance.

Exploratory findings suggest transferability with reweighting. Cross-cultural participants treated text/AI as a "necessary but effortful manual" and activities as the experiential core; children dismissed AI videos as "funny background" (with sharp critiques such as "AI is not ready yet, it's very unsafe") and responded to embodiment as a "universal language." These are small samples (N=4N=47 and N=4N=48) with no inferential statistics, so they should be read as directional only.

Discussion and design implications

The discussion frames AI-generated visual content as "a bridge full of gaps": effective for scene-level semantic scaffolding, but prone to uncanny-valley dissonance in dynamic scenarios due to failures in physical credibility, temporal coherence, and emotional expression. The style findings motivate a positioning of AIGC as a "preliminary framework" rather than final representation, favoring stylized modes that disclose uncertainty over hyperrealism. The central empirical contribution is quantified evidence for the embodied path: the +1.66 IOS gain and the presence–resonance correlation align with situated-action accounts of cognition and distinguish this work from single-artifact, single-user heritage systems.

From the KANO structure, the authors derive five design probes: (A) physical credibility of visual symbols; (B) visualization of social frameworks and turn-taking mechanisms; (C) multisensory atmosphere; (D) ritualization of behavioral flow; and (E) AI content explainability and style management. Probe E is particularly actionable—it converts AI limitations into an acceptable stylistic register rather than a defect, directly addressing the negative reactions observed in the video condition.

Limitations and open questions

The paper is candid about several constraints. The cross-cultural and child groups are too small for inference; the order counterbalancing involved modest per-group sizes, limiting power to detect subtle order effects despite the significant IOS order result. The embodied setting was an indoor prototype rather than a historically reconstructed context, leaving open whether effects hold in gamified VR or situated deployments in museums and schools. The AI content reflects general-purpose models' current weaknesses in physical plausibility; targeted cultural-activity datasets or customized pipelines remain untested. An additional open question concerns durability: all measures were collected within a single ~60-minute session, so whether gains in closeness and resonance persist beyond the session is not established.

Conclusion

GatheringSense provides empirical support for treating AI-generated multimodal content and embodied participation as complementary rather than substitutive paths in cultural understanding. AI media reliably raise symbol readability and establish a mid-high baseline of cultural resonance; embodied, socially structured interaction produces the substantial gains in presence, psychological closeness, and resonance, with an order advantage when embodiment precedes AI viewing. The KANO results redirect design attention from didactic knowledge delivery toward personalization, ritual participation, and social exploration. The main caveats—small supplementary groups, limited statistical power for order effects, prototype-level embodiment, and current AIGC physical-coherence deficits—define the immediate agenda for validating and extending the dual-path framework in more diverse populations and deployed cultural settings.
